Miles Davis 10/17/73
Jazz Workshop, Boston, MA
Set I
Ife (M. Davis)
Agharta Prelude (M. Davis)
Foster and Mtume play the "Tune in 5" percussion vamp from 2:42-7:10, while Henderson, Lucas, and the soloists continue with "Agharta Prelude."
Zimbabwe (M. Davis)

Comment
Miles Davis - Trumpet
Dave Liebman - Sax
Reggie Lucas - Guitar
Pete Cosey - Guitar, Percussion
Michael Henderson - Bass
Al Foster - Drums
James Mtume Forman - Percussion

WBCN radio broadcast

The Davis Septet was booked for several nights at the Jazz Workshop in mid-October 1973, and there is an audience recording of two sets from another show during this engagement. Given the tunes performed here, this is probably from the second of two sets on this date.

A week earlier, Liebman took a couple days off to record Lookout Farm at Generation Sound Studios in New York (October 10-11).
